The idea is that WebRTC's code interacting with hardware is mostly unused in Chromium
The following revision refers to this bug: https://chromium.googlesource.com/chromium/tools/build/+/c732512120c4ea33cd04711b0e519d33bf7dd306 commit c732512120c4ea33cd04711b0e519d33bf7dd306 Author: Oleh Prypin <oprypin@webrtc.org> Date: Mon Mar 19 12:19:59 2018 Don't run baremetal tests in chromium.webrtc.fyi Bug: chromium:822719 Change-Id: I052961bde4515957b85ec77d7d8729474cc24be4 Reviewed-on: https://chromium-review.googlesource.com/966445 Commit-Queue: Oleh Prypin <oprypin@chromium.org> Reviewed-by: Patrik Höglund <phoglund@chromium.org> [modify] https://crrev.com/c732512120c4ea33cd04711b0e519d33bf7dd306/scripts/slave/recipe_modules/chromium_tests/chromium_webrtc_fyi.py [modify] https://crrev.com/c732512120c4ea33cd04711b0e519d33bf7dd306/scripts/slave/recipe_modules/chromium_tests/chromium_webrtc.py
The following revision refers to this bug: https://chromium.googlesource.com/chromium/tools/build/+/87e3ebdce85a19e53261dd103a385ff235951031 commit 87e3ebdce85a19e53261dd103a385ff235951031 Author: Oleh Prypin <oprypin@webrtc.org> Date: Wed Mar 21 09:02:55 2018 Switch chromium.webrtc.fyi to swarming Bug: chromium:822719 Change-Id: Ia8af32684b2aa8d44313d684db9d51a1a05ef71f Reviewed-on: https://chromium-review.googlesource.com/969121 Reviewed-by: Patrik Höglund <phoglund@chromium.org> Reviewed-by: Michael Achenbach <machenbach@chromium.org> Commit-Queue: Oleh Prypin <oprypin@chromium.org> [modify] https://crrev.com/87e3ebdce85a19e53261dd103a385ff235951031/scripts/slave/recipe_modules/chromium_tests/chromium_webrtc_fyi.py [modify] https://crrev.com/87e3ebdce85a19e53261dd103a385ff235951031/scripts/slave/recipe_modules/chromium_tests/chromium_webrtc.py
The following revision refers to this bug: https://chromium.googlesource.com/chromium/tools/build/+/c63cdeb60f1042d5f2e8f3207d895aed00c9dba1 commit c63cdeb60f1042d5f2e8f3207d895aed00c9dba1 Author: Oleh Prypin <oprypin@webrtc.org> Date: Wed Mar 21 14:42:15 2018 Exempt WebRtcApprtcBrowserTest from swarming There's no isolate support for AppRTC and it would be inefficient to copy it around anyway Bug: chromium:822719 Change-Id: Ic2afd304dc5f98af98f45743577f554b628a5745 Reviewed-on: https://chromium-review.googlesource.com/973282 Reviewed-by: Patrik Höglund <phoglund@chromium.org> Commit-Queue: Oleh Prypin <oprypin@chromium.org> [modify] https://crrev.com/c63cdeb60f1042d5f2e8f3207d895aed00c9dba1/scripts/slave/recipe_modules/chromium_tests/chromium_webrtc.py
The following revision refers to this bug: https://chromium.googlesource.com/chromium/tools/build/+/2aac2ba1703d6d66e697e7e3aa613838b09da907 commit 2aac2ba1703d6d66e697e7e3aa613838b09da907 Author: Oleh Prypin <oprypin@webrtc.org> Date: Wed Mar 21 14:43:16 2018 Remove perf dashboard IDs from chromium.webrtc.fyi It does not run performance tests anymore Bug: chromium:822719 Change-Id: I0d610a620bbbfc84ce58106d4727b369e5e45e7f Reviewed-on: https://chromium-review.googlesource.com/973361 Reviewed-by: Patrik Höglund <phoglund@chromium.org> Commit-Queue: Oleh Prypin <oprypin@chromium.org> [modify] https://crrev.com/2aac2ba1703d6d66e697e7e3aa613838b09da907/scripts/slave/recipe_modules/chromium_tests/chromium_webrtc_fyi.py [modify] https://crrev.com/2aac2ba1703d6d66e697e7e3aa613838b09da907/scripts/slave/recipe_modules/chromium_tests/chromium_webrtc.py
The following revision refers to this bug: https://chromium.googlesource.com/chromium/tools/build/+/04b6e58fa0b49a9b74381a0c9985c179d7dd1911 commit 04b6e58fa0b49a9b74381a0c9985c179d7dd1911 Author: Oleh Prypin <oprypin@webrtc.org> Date: Wed Mar 21 15:24:45 2018 WebRTC: Replace obsolete Android builders and use swarming There is no need for a big variety of devices, just add one with a recent Android vversion Bug: chromium:822719 Change-Id: Ib18a37ba310cc6775734e504966eaecbd16cf99b Reviewed-on: https://chromium-review.googlesource.com/973447 Commit-Queue: Oleh Prypin <oprypin@chromium.org> Reviewed-by: Patrik Höglund <phoglund@chromium.org> [modify] https://crrev.com/04b6e58fa0b49a9b74381a0c9985c179d7dd1911/scripts/slave/recipe_modules/chromium_tests/chromium_webrtc_fyi.py [modify] https://crrev.com/04b6e58fa0b49a9b74381a0c9985c179d7dd1911/masters/master.chromium.webrtc.fyi/master_builders_cfg.py [modify] https://crrev.com/04b6e58fa0b49a9b74381a0c9985c179d7dd1911/masters/master.chromium.webrtc.fyi/slaves.cfg
The following revision refers to this bug: https://chromium.googlesource.com/infra/infra/+/5356fcdec90a01bc6878eee0c4e89067ae07b79d commit 5356fcdec90a01bc6878eee0c4e89067ae07b79d Author: Oleh Prypin <oprypin@webrtc.org> Date: Wed Mar 21 16:04:36 2018 WebRTC: Replace obsolete Android builders from LKGR Bug: chromium:822719 Change-Id: Ic9cb36b57dd64df08a4ff89c9cdc4f56c4620033 Reviewed-on: https://chromium-review.googlesource.com/973363 Reviewed-by: Patrik Höglund <phoglund@chromium.org> Commit-Queue: Oleh Prypin <oprypin@chromium.org> [modify] https://crrev.com/5356fcdec90a01bc6878eee0c4e89067ae07b79d/infra/services/lkgr_finder/config/webrtc_cfg.pyl
The following revision refers to this bug: https://chromium.googlesource.com/chromium/tools/build/+/0cea07bce606d91141a6e03fc372f0b8448531e9 commit 0cea07bce606d91141a6e03fc372f0b8448531e9 Author: Oleh Prypin <oprypin@webrtc.org> Date: Fri Mar 23 12:44:16 2018 Use Nexus5X devices with Android M because N has an unstable pool Bug: chromium:822719 Change-Id: I62acd7578d10be2f93ac0d51e2d727c7599bc36a Reviewed-on: https://chromium-review.googlesource.com/976225 Reviewed-by: Patrik Höglund <phoglund@chromium.org> Commit-Queue: Oleh Prypin <oprypin@chromium.org> [modify] https://crrev.com/0cea07bce606d91141a6e03fc372f0b8448531e9/scripts/slave/recipe_modules/chromium_tests/chromium_webrtc_fyi.py [modify] https://crrev.com/0cea07bce606d91141a6e03fc372f0b8448531e9/masters/master.chromium.webrtc.fyi/master_builders_cfg.py [modify] https://crrev.com/0cea07bce606d91141a6e03fc372f0b8448531e9/masters/master.chromium.webrtc.fyi/slaves.cfg
The following revision refers to this bug: https://chromium.googlesource.com/infra/infra/+/64d86bf843818e26bb5fecdaa98bb14cc6f34430 commit 64d86bf843818e26bb5fecdaa98bb14cc6f34430 Author: Oleh Prypin <oprypin@webrtc.org> Date: Fri Mar 23 13:01:35 2018 WebRTC: Update builder name (switched to Android M) in LKGR Bug: chromium:822719 Change-Id: I520ebfe834b6227b140223686b0ad42a5be71f8f Reviewed-on: https://chromium-review.googlesource.com/977661 Reviewed-by: Patrik Höglund <phoglund@chromium.org> Commit-Queue: Oleh Prypin <oprypin@chromium.org> [modify] https://crrev.com/64d86bf843818e26bb5fecdaa98bb14cc6f34430/infra/services/lkgr_finder/config/webrtc_cfg.pyl
The following revision refers to this bug: https://chromium.googlesource.com/chromium/tools/build/+/5216d333bda3d320803cb16160cad0ff5f832cf2 commit 5216d333bda3d320803cb16160cad0ff5f832cf2 Author: Oleh Prypin <oprypin@webrtc.org> Date: Tue Apr 03 06:51:03 2018 Replace baremetal machines with VMs in chromium.webrtc.fyi Bug: chromium:822719 , chromium:822729 Change-Id: I2df4ff877d4945337296b99db3eb66028106355a Reviewed-on: https://chromium-review.googlesource.com/985833 Commit-Queue: Oleh Prypin <oprypin@chromium.org> Reviewed-by: Patrik Höglund <phoglund@chromium.org> [modify] https://crrev.com/5216d333bda3d320803cb16160cad0ff5f832cf2/masters/master.chromium.webrtc.fyi/slaves.cfg
You still haven't sent anything to webrtc-perf-sheriffs@; they need to know that the perf tests no longer run on the FYI bots. It might be worth PSA:ing this to webrtc-eng as well.
??? g/webrtc-eng/TU4GBzPHQJA
Ah! Never mind then.
[bulk-edit: disregard if N/A] Can the owner please set milestone to this bug if applicable?
Comment 1 by oprypin@chromium.org
, Mar 16 2018